When Are Mayflies Coming to Michigan?

Warmer temperatures around Lake Erie and the other Great Lakes waters, are slowly creeping up past 68 degrees, which in turn is getting the mayfly's up and ready to wreck havoc on your life. The mayfly's are expected to hit us the hardest here in Michigan around June 15th-22nd.

Before we all freak out though, seeing mayflies here in the state of Michigan, is actually a really good thing. No, really they are.

Why Are Mayflies Swarming the Great Lakes?

Mayflies here in a state where we have so many fresh water sources is great. Mayflies signify a healthy and clean lake. Now, the bad part of course, is that they stick around and bug you, but for about a day before they disappear. The good news, is they don't bite or sting either.

While they may be a nuisance to see year after a year, it's also a good sign. Just avoid driving under streetlights at night to keep them away from you and your cars. If they're on your patio, just grab the hose and spray them off, it's a good way to get rid of them if they're truly bugging you.
